Weather & Climate in Rossie, IA
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.
Rossie exper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 47°F (8°C). Winters average 17°F in January while summers reach 73°F in July. The area gets 291 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 26.8 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43. The city sits at an elevation of 1,410 feet.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 17°F (-8°C) | 0.5 in | Coldest, Driest |
| February | 21°F (-6°C) | 0.7 in | |
| March | 33°F (0°C) | 1.9 in | |
| April | 47°F (8°C) | 2.7 in | |
| May | 60°F (15°C) | 3.5 in | |
| June | 69°F (21°C) | 4.2 in | Wettest |
| July | 73°F (23°C) | 3.9 in | Warmest |
| August | 70°F (21°C) | 3.9 in | |
| September | 62°F (17°C) | 3.4 in | |
| October | 49°F (10°C) | 2.1 in | |
| November | 33°F (0°C) | 1.2 in | |
| December | 20°F (-7°C) | 0.8 in |
Rossie has a seasonal temperature swing of 57°F / from 17°F in January to 73°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 29.0 inches, with June being the wettest month (4.2") and January the driest (0.5").
